almonella Shigella Agar is a selective and differential medium used for the isolation of Salmonella and Shigella species from stool samples. It can also be used for testing food samples.
Ready-to-Use MacConkey Agar is used for the selective isolation and identification of Enterobacteria from stool, urine, wastewater, and food samples. It is also a selective and differential medium for enteric Gram-negative bacteria.
